Circling: 1978-1987 is a 1993 poetry collection by the Serbian-American poet Dejan Stojanović . It contains 56 poems in six sequences: "Recircling," "Light Bugs," "A Conversations with Atoms," "A Grain," "A Warden with no Keys," and "Darkness Is Waiting." Sequence, "A Grain," was added to the third edition published in 2000 by Narodna knjiga, Alfa, Beograd.
